Kettering Cycling Club was formed in 2000, through the
amalgamation of the town’s two long standing clubs Kettering
Amateur CC and Kettering Friendly CC. The club has in the region
of 100 members, of which one-third race regularly. The club is
best noted for its time trialling, with an annual series held on
numerous courses. Kettering CC also runs mountain bike, road and
open time trials races, plus we run a weekly club run over the
winter period, at 9.30am every Sunday morning outside
Sainsbury’s petrol station on Rockingham Road. The club now has
gained ‘British Cycling’ Go-Ride status, where we run cycle
sessions for people from 5 to 16 years old, on an off road area.
This scheme runs all kinds of exciting skills and techniques,
aimed at developing a rider’s bike ability and confidence all in
a safe environment.
The club itself has a broad range of riders, both young and old,
male and female from the most dedicated cyclist through to
